pub struct PathBuilder { /* private fields */ }Implementations§
Source§impl PathBuilder
impl PathBuilder
Source§impl PathBuilder
impl PathBuilder
pub fn index_value(&mut self) -> &mut Self
Source§impl PathBuilder
impl PathBuilder
Sourcepub fn mapped_generic_pack(&mut self, mapped_type: TypePackId) -> &mut Self
pub fn mapped_generic_pack(&mut self, mapped_type: TypePackId) -> &mut Self
components.emplace_back(GenericPackMapping{mappedType}).
Reference: TypePath.cpp:269-272.
Source§impl PathBuilder
impl PathBuilder
pub fn pack_slice(&mut self, start_index: usize) -> &mut Self
Source§impl PathBuilder
impl PathBuilder
pub fn write_prop(&mut self, name: &str) -> &mut Self
Source§impl PathBuilder
impl PathBuilder
Trait Implementations§
Source§impl Clone for PathBuilder
impl Clone for PathBuilder
Source§fn clone(&self) -> PathBuilder
fn clone(&self) -> PathBuilder
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for PathBuilder
impl Debug for PathBuilder
Source§impl Default for PathBuilder
impl Default for PathBuilder
Source§impl PathBuilderArgs for PathBuilder
impl PathBuilderArgs for PathBuilder
Source§impl PathBuilderBuild for PathBuilder
impl PathBuilderBuild for PathBuilder
Source§impl PathBuilderIndex for PathBuilder
impl PathBuilderIndex for PathBuilder
Source§impl PathBuilderLb for PathBuilder
impl PathBuilderLb for PathBuilder
Source§impl PathBuilderMt for PathBuilder
impl PathBuilderMt for PathBuilder
Source§impl PathBuilderNegated for PathBuilder
impl PathBuilderNegated for PathBuilder
Source§impl PathBuilderRets for PathBuilder
impl PathBuilderRets for PathBuilder
Source§impl PathBuilderTail for PathBuilder
impl PathBuilderTail for PathBuilder
Source§impl PathBuilderUb for PathBuilder
impl PathBuilderUb for PathBuilder
Source§impl PathBuilderVariadic for PathBuilder
impl PathBuilderVariadic for PathBuilder
Auto Trait Implementations§
impl !Send for PathBuilder
impl !Sync for PathBuilder
impl Freeze for PathBuilder
impl RefUnwindSafe for PathBuilder
impl Unpin for PathBuilder
impl UnsafeUnpin for PathBuilder
impl UnwindSafe for PathB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more